Chapter 7: Shapes and Patterns

Look at a beehive, a kite, a tile floor, a marigold garland. All of these are made of shapes repeated in clever ways. Mathematicians call these arrangements patterns. Patterns are everywhere , in nature, in temples, in rangolis, in textiles.

In this chapter we meet a fresh batch of shapes , different kinds of triangles and quadrilaterals , and we learn how patterns are made by repeating, flipping, and turning them. By the end, you will see geometry hiding inside ordinary tiles and curtains.
